Rising unemployment in Canada: June data
July 5, 2024
Canada’s unemployment rate rose to 6.4 percent in June as total employment fell during the month, Statistics Canada reported Friday.
The report showed employers eliminated a total of 1,400 jobs in June. That figure compares with an unemployment rate of 6.2 percent in May, when the economy added 27,000 jobs. The Bank of Canada expects a slowdown in the labour market, particularly in wage growth.
